Transaction 34a25925c0ff2f8721483b430141d0598caf903df1a060061a30ba3b21799d92
1 Input
1 Output
-
34a25925c0ff2f8721483b430141d0598caf903df1a060061a30ba3b21799d92:0
- value
- 38609
- script pubkey
- OP_0 OP_PUSHBYTES_20 908cea6e5a3a9de86aaf20eefac432b764dfbf37
- address
- bc1qjzxw5mj682w7s640yrh043pjkajdl0ehe6l9fk